Marigold Overview
Lisa Mayr serves as the Chief Executive Officer, bringing extensive experience in global leadership across technology and software organizations.
Marigold offers a suite of distinct products tailored to different organizational needs.
Campaign Monitor provides smart and powerful email marketing solutions, ideal for small businesses and agencies seeking to jumpstart their efforts.
Emma focuses on automating and personalizing campaigns while ensuring brand consistency, catering to busy marketers in sectors like higher education, nonprofits, franchises, and growing businesses. For professional services firms, Vuture delivers personalized, data-driven communications through real-time CRM integration. While Marigold's enterprise products have been acquired by Zeta Global, the company continues to provide scalable marketing solutions specifically for small and mid-size organizations under its current offerings.
Headquartered in Nashville, Tennessee, Marigold operates as a global entity, collaborating with a diverse, international team to tackle challenges across various markets and cultures. The company prioritizes the security of customer data, employing a defense-in-depth strategy that secures information across multiple layers, as detailed in their Trust Center.
Marigold (formerly CM Group before its rebrand) has been recognized for its innovation in martech, consistently earning accolades such as "Best Overall Email Marketing Company" by MarTech Breakthrough for four consecutive years, highlighting its expertise in email marketing and broader relationship marketing solutions.

Marigold Product and Pricing Intelligence
Marigold operates on a subscription plan model, where customers select a subscription type on an Ordering Document that outlines the base set of services and applicable volume limits. Different subscription plans come with varying services associated with them [meetmarigold.com/company/compliance/services-agreement]. This allows for a tailored approach, adapting to a client's team structure, capabilities, and budget [meetmarigold.com/why-marigold/marigold-services].
Although specific pricing tiers and detailed plan costs are not publicly disclosed on their website, Marigold emphasizes flexible service models. These models can range from end-to-end creation and execution of a program, including strategic design, build, configuration, segmentation, QA, and deployment, to options where clients manage the communication aspects themselves [meetmarigold.com/why-marigold/marigold-services]. For growing brands, Marigold often suggests a full-service model to support strategy, program launch, operations, and growth, aiming to accelerate results [meetmarigold.com/resources/research/rewarding-profit-a-loyalty-buyers-guide-for-growing-brands].

Marigold Management and Leadership Team
Recent leadership changes at Marigold have seen Lisa Mayr appointed as Chief Executive Officer [meetmarigold.com/company/leadership]. Lisa Mayr brings over 30 years of global leadership experience in finance and operations across technology and software organizations. She previously served as Marigold’s Chief Financial Officer, where she was instrumental in driving financial discipline, scalable growth, and strategic value creation. This transition follows Mike Gordon's tenure as CEO, who was appointed in April 2024, succeeding Wellford Dillard [meetmarigold.com/company/press-news/marigoldtmappoints-mike-gordon-as-chief-executive-officer]. Wellford Dillard had led the company for over seven years and introduced Marigold in January 2023, unifying its global martech solutions under one brand [meetmarigold.com/company/press-news/introducing-marigoldtm-the-first-martech-company-to-deliver-relationship-marketing-solutions-that-drive-lifetime-loyalty].
The Marigold leadership team also includes Micki Howl, who serves as Chief Operating Officer [meetmarigold.com/company/press-news/marigoldtm-expands-and-bolsters-global-strategy-and-services-division]. The company is also committed to enhancing its strategic partnerships, with Andy Gladwin promoted to lead the strategic vision as Head of Partnerships in February 2023, following Marigold's rebrand from CM Group [meetmarigold.com/company/press-news/marigoldtm-announces-enhanced-partner-ecosystem]. This reflects Marigold's dedication to innovation across its portfolio of purpose-built solutions for small and mid-size organizations.

Marigold offers extensive technology integrations to ensure seamless data flow and enhanced functionality across various platforms. Their pre-built connectors provide automated bi-directional synchronization, supporting advanced segmentation, personalization, and machine learning capabilities. These connectors are available for Marigold Loyalty, Cheetah Digital, and Selligent (Marigold Engage), among others. Furthermore, Grow by Marigold integrates directly with Selligent, Cheetah Digital, and Sailthru, as well as external providers like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ager, Campaign Monitor, and Emma. For custom solutions, an HTTP integration is also available. For Marigold Loyalty, integrations extend to Zeta Global applications and third-party platforms, including POS systems and e-commerce providers to capture in-store and online purchases, as well as mobile payment options like Apple Pay and Android Pay, showcasing a broad and adaptable integration strategy for a comprehensive marketing ecosystem.
